Import incomplete nav database fullto
« on: October 13, 2016, 08:24:43 AM »

Hello all, trying to import a .Gpx route only 26kb and I keep receiving the same error. Tried resetting Pri and pre information as a previous post suggested. Deleting all saved nav items with no success.
Any ideas? I am on the latest update.

Re: Import incomplete nav database fullto
« Reply #1 on: October 13, 2016, 08:44:03 AM »

How may trip files do you already have loaded...or how many trips are trying to load.

I saw this once when I tried to load all my trips for a three week trip.  Ended up loading half and deleting trips as used...then loaded the other half while on the road.

Also when you go to import the gpx file are you selecting import all or just the route.  I import just the route and works fine.  If you import all you end up storing all the waypoint which takes up memory.
